Special Statement from Simcoe Muskoka's Medial Officer Of Health
On Monday, Simcoe Muskoka moved into the Orange-Restrict Level for Covid - 19. Today via it's social media channels, the Simcoe Muskoka District Health Unit shared a special message from Medical Officer of Health, Dr. Charles Gardner.

One sled towed, the other ditched, and two sledders facing charges
Bracebridge Ontario Provincial Police have charged two sledders after spotting two motorized snow vehicles (MSV) in Gravenhurst just before 4am on January 24, 2021. One stopped, and the other was found upside down in a ditch. Two Gravenhurst men are facing a number of charges under the MSV act. -
